operator616
Senior Member

Gender:
Location: BTAS

Yes. It was first in Dr Destiny's possession, then Profitt (later becoming Red King) stole it from him (or at least a small part of it) and used it to create countless universes. I made a little mistake by confusing them regarding the universes creation.

Read JLA:Classified #32-36 if you're interested in full details.
